Professional Education and KOL Manager
$100,000–$120,000 year
On-site · Cincinnati, Ohio, United States
Job Summary
Lead KOL engagement strategy and maintain relationships with physicians, surgeons, and healthcare institutions to support clinical, scientific, and commercial objectives. Design and deliver comprehensive physician education programs (Centers of Excellence training, hands-on workshops, site visits, and advisory boards), and plan end-to-end education events, webinars, and user meetings; provide tradeshow support. Ensure compliance and continuous improvement through accurate HCP documentation and Sunshine Act reporting; analyze event outcomes to drive data-informed improvements. Requires travel up to 40% (Spring higher; potential international trips), and collaboration within the Americas Commercial Marketing Team.
Required Qualifications
- Bachelor’s degree in business, marketing, communications, management, education, or related field
- 5+ years of experience in professional education, clinical affairs, marketing, or sales
- Travel up to 40%, including potential overnight international trips
- Experience working with KOLs (Key Opinion Leaders) in medical device, healthcare, or pharmaceutical industries
- Knowledge of Sunshine Act reporting and physician education programs
- Ability to design and deliver physician education programs (CoEs, hands-on workshops, advisory boards, webinars)
- Strong relationship management and communication skills
